Re 2) It is still the case that the highly pathogenic H5N1 virus, the most die-wild bird on the spot. If not, there would be more radial off-breitungszonen to the outbreaks, and in the short term. VER should also be detected in several wild birds carrying the virus. Instead, the virus is clearly detected only in dead and dying animals. In Hong Kong in recent years sampled about 16,000 live wild birds - all negative. All found there with the virus infected wild birds were dead (Martin Williams via e-mail). Thereafter, the incubation period of the (classical) with avian influenza 1-7 days specified ben, and the disease duration of 1-5 days. This leaves an infected bird 2-12 days (in which he can fly too), to carry the pathogen on. In excretion of duck virus at 4 ° C for 30 days were infectious, at 20 ° C for 4 days. In summer, they are rapidly inactivated by ultraviolet light. In seawater kotverschmutztem the virus at 0 ° C to 30 days are infectious at 22 ° C only 4 days.
